I hope this isn’t awkward, but to be honest with everyone, I wasn’t sure I wanted to do this interview. I wasn’t sure the idea was big enough—it seemed too simplistic. But then I had a conversation with today’s guest and I got fired up.

Here’s the deal. This guy had an idea that started as a post. He didn’t create the software, he didn’t go out and get customers. What he did instead was create a conference, he got people to come, and that’s how he got some of his first customers.

Today he’s becoming the leader in this whole new category of software that I’d never heard of before this interview.

Sangram Vajre is the cofounder of Terminus, the leading b2b account-based automation software.
